Front-End Engineer
il y a 2 semaines
Role
We're building
an e-commerce management platform that does everything
. You'll turn API contracts into fast, reliable UIs—dashboards, forms, tables, and KPIs—used daily by our ops team. This is a hybrid role based in Casablanca with flexible WFH.
What you'll do
- Build responsive
dashboards & CRUD screens
(lists, filters, pagination, bulk actions). - Implement robust
forms
with react-hook-form + Zod (validation, error/empty/loading states). - Create reusable components with
Tailwind + shadcn/ui
and keep the design system consistent. - Integrate
typed API clients
generated from
OpenAPI
; handle auth/permissions in the UI. - Ship
charts/KPIs
(Recharts/Tremor) and hit
Lighthouse ≥90
on core pages. - Add telemetry & error handling (Sentry) and participate in code reviews.
 
Qualifications (must-have)
- 3–5 years
with
and
TypeScript
in production. - Strong UI fundamentals: tables, forms, routing, state management,
accessibility basics
. - Comfortable consuming REST APIs from a
typed client
(OpenAPI). - Solid CSS/Tailwind skills and careful attention to responsive/mobile details.
 - Clear communication, ownership, and steady delivery (small, reviewable PRs).
 
Nice to have
- shadcn/ui
, TipTap, data virtualization, SSR/ISR performance tuning. - Familiarity with
AI UI patterns
(streaming responses/suggestions) and wiring
AI APIs
from the frontend. - Testing/Storybook habits; analytics events; i18n (French).
 
- 
					
						Front End Developer
il y a 2 semaines
Casablanca, Casablanca-Settat, Maroc Atlas Defenders Temps plein 120 000 - 240 000 par anAbout Atlas DefendersAtlas Defenders is an emerging startup dedicated to providing innovative IT solutions and cybersecurity services for businesses across the globe. Our mission is to help organizations secure, optimize, and modernize their IT infrastructure while delivering real-world, practical technology solutions.At Atlas Defenders, we believe in...
 - 
					
						Full Stack Engineer
il y a 1 semaine
Casablanca, Casablanca-Settat, Maroc ATOZ Services Temps plein 40 000 - 60 000 par anRole DescriptionThis is a full-time role for a Full Stack Engineer (Angular, Spring Boot, Postgres). The candidate should expect to be responsible for developing and maintaining both front-end and back-end components of web applications. Daily tasks include designing user interactions on web pages, creating servers and databases for functionality, and...
 - 
					
						Full Stack Engineer
il y a 4 jours
Casablanca, Casablanca-Settat, Maroc Atracio Temps plein 40 000 - 60 000 par anJob DetailsDepartmentResearch and DevelopmentLocationCasablanca, MoroccoJob TypeSoftware EngineeringExperience2YearsResponsibilitiesAs a Full Stack Engineer at Atracio, you will be responsible for the end-to-end development of our ERP system, ensuring seamless integration and optimal performance. Your primary responsibilities will include:Designing,...
 - 
					
Tech Lead Software Engineer
il y a 1 semaine
Casablanca, Casablanca-Settat, Maroc IDEMIA Temps plein 70 000 - 120 000 par anJob DescriptionVotre rôle en tant que Tech LeadEn tant queTech Lead Software Engineer, vous serez leréférent techniqueau sein d'une équipe de 10 personnes (développeurs, QA, Product Owner, Scrum Master). Vous interviendrez sur leback-end Javaet lefront-end React, tout en accompagnant les équipes dans la conception, le développement et la livraison de...
 - 
					
Tech Lead Software Engineer
il y a 1 semaine
Casablanca, Casablanca-Settat, Maroc IDEMIA Temps plein 45 000 - 90 000 par anSince our founding, IDEMIA has been on a mission to unlock the world and make it safer through our cutting-edge identity technologies. Our technology leadership makes us the partner of choice for hundreds of governments and thousands of enterprises in over 180 countries, including some of the biggest and most influential brands in the world. In applying our...
 - 
					
						lead devops engineer
il y a 2 semaines
Casablanca, Casablanca-Settat, Maroc RED TIC Temps plein 900 000 - 1 200 000 par anFreelanceCasablancaPublié il y a 3 moisRED TIC recrute pour l'un de ses partenaires un profil LEAD DEVOPS ENGINEER.Mission : EParticipation aux différentes phases projet: Design / Build / RUN :Infrastructure ENGINEERRéception et analyse des dossiers d'ArchitectureBuild : VMs, Services Cloud, …Réalisation des documents liés à l'implémentation de...
 - 
					
						Web Engineer
il y a 2 semaines
Casablanca, Casablanca-Settat, Maroc Arrow Electronics Temps pleinPosition:Web EngineerJob Description:Arrow Enterprise Computing Solutions (ECS), a part of Arrow Electronics, brings innovative IT solutions to market to solve complex business challenges. We deliver value-added distribution, business consulting and channel enablement services to leading technology manufacturers and their channel partners. We help businesses...
 - 
					
						Web Engineer
il y a 2 semaines
Casablanca, Casablanca-Settat, Maroc Arrow Electronics Temps pleinPosition:Web EngineerJob Description: Arrow Enterprise Computing Solutions (ECS), a part of Arrow Electronics, brings innovative IT solutions to market to solve complex business challenges. We deliver value-added distribution, business consulting and channel enablement services to leading technology manufacturers and their channel partners. We help...
 - 
					
						software engineer
il y a 2 jours
Casablanca, Casablanca-Settat, Maroc Intelcia Temps plein 900 000 - 1 200 000 par anMissionsNous recherchons un(e) Intégrateur Web pour rejoindre notre équipe. il sera chargé(e) de transformer des designs UX/UI en pages web fonctionnelles et optimisées, tout en respectant les normes de qualité et les bonnes pratiques de développement front-end.Missions principales : Intégrer des maquettes UX/UI en HTML5, CSS3 et JavaScript (si...
 - 
					
						Recrutement – Profils variés en IT, Marketing, Design
il y a 2 jours
Casablanca, Casablanca-Settat, Maroc Qalqul engine Temps plein 60 000 - 120 000 par anNous recrutons à Casablanca Vous souhaitez évoluer dans un environnement innovant et collaboratif ?QALQUL ENGINE, entreprise technologique basée à Casablanca, agrandit son équipe et recherche de nouveaux talents passionnés par le digital, les télécoms et le développement.Postes ouverts :Marketing & Sales (3 profils – Stage préembauche)Prospection...